REGARDING STOP AND FRISK
NEW YORK, NY – City Comptroller John C. Liu issued the following statement today on a federal judge’s ruling to allow class-action status in a stop and frisk lawsuit:
“Today’s ruling should serve as a wakeup call to put an end to the stop and frisk policy that disproportionately impacts Blacks and Latinos and exposes the City to serious financial liability. Taxpayers can’t afford ill-conceived practices that poison the relationship between our communities and the police, a relationship that is vital to maintaining a safe and secure city for all New Yorkers. Stop and frisk should be abolished.”
